Job Duties of a Room Attendant/Hotel Cleaner

  • Registering individuals and monitoring them.
  • Arranging reservations for lodging or any other hotel service, such as eating.
  • Check walks are conducted for security and other purposes.
  • Completing household chores as they become due.
  • Cleaning and upkeep are necessary for hotel lobbies, waiting areas, welcome areas, and other public spaces.
  • Keeping specified or assigned areas clean and in order.
  • Cleaning the hotel’s kitchen or eating area, meeting spaces, and restrooms.
  • Monitoring the cleaning supply inventory and replenishing it as necessary, or reporting any issues or obstructions resulting from a scarcity of cleaning supplies to the General Manager or Housekeeping Manager.
